What should I consider when planning a driveway, patio, or garden bed project?
Think about how the surface will be used, required depth, and whether you need a compactable base or a loose finish for planting. Different aggregate mixes work better for load-bearing driveways versus decorative beds, so factor in drainage and maintenance. Plan for edging, a proper base, and slightly more material than calculated to account for compaction and waste.
How do I estimate how much material I need for a job in Lincoln?
Measure length, width, and desired depth, then use a cubic yard or ton calculator to convert those numbers into an order quantity. Remember our 3-ton minimum on orders and that densities vary by material, so use the calculator on our site or contact sales for help. Ordering 5-10% extra is common to cover compaction and grading adjustments.

Do you deliver to rural roads and small properties near Lincoln?
We serve Lincoln and nearby West Alabama zip codes, but availability can vary by address so check your zip code at checkout. Deliveries are made by dump trucks (typically tri-axle), so provide clear access, a stable drop zone, and note any narrow roads, low overhead lines, or weight-restricted bridges. If access is limited, tell us at checkout so we can coordinate the right equipment.
How does Lincoln's climate affect material choice and performance?
Hot, humid summers and frequent rain in this region increase the importance of drainage and erosion resistance. Choose materials and installation methods that shed water, allow for settling, and resist washing or rutting during storms. For plant-based projects, account for faster decomposition and possible weed pressure in humid conditions.

How should I prepare my property for a bulk material delivery?
Clear the intended drop area of vehicles, toys, and fragile landscaping, and mark the exact spot for the truck to dump. Ensure access paths are wide and stable enough for a tri-axle dump truck and protect nearby plants or structures with boards or tarps if needed. Communicate any special instructions in the Order Notes so the driver knows site conditions before arrival.
